What are the factors that could cause another drop in the price of bitcoin?

- One possible factor that could cause a drop in the price of bitcoin is increased regulatory scrutiny. If governments around the world implement stricter regulations on cryptocurrencies, it could lead to a decrease in demand and ultimately a decline in price. Additionally, negative news or events related to security breaches, hacks, or scams in the cryptocurrency industry can also shake investor confidence and result in a drop in bitcoin's price.

- Another factor that could contribute to a drop in the price of bitcoin is a significant market sell-off. If a large number of bitcoin holders decide to sell their holdings simultaneously, it can create a supply-demand imbalance and push the price downwards. This can be triggered by various reasons such as economic uncertainty, global financial crises, or even panic selling due to fear of a potential price drop.

- Well, let me tell you, one of the factors that might cause another drop in the price of bitcoin is market manipulation. You see, there are some unscrupulous individuals or groups out there who engage in practices like spoofing, wash trading, or pump and dump schemes to artificially influence the price of bitcoin. These manipulative activities can create false market signals and lead to a sudden drop in price when the manipulation is exposed or when the manipulators decide to exit the market.

- As an expert in the field, I can tell you that another potential factor that could cause a drop in the price of bitcoin is a significant technological flaw or vulnerability. If a critical vulnerability is discovered in the underlying technology or infrastructure of bitcoin, it could undermine trust in the system and lead to a sell-off by investors. This is why it's crucial for developers and security experts to continuously monitor and address any potential weaknesses in the bitcoin network.
